Danfoss BFPM 52 Oil Pump
Datasheet
Description
The BFPM product range includes Danfoss oil pumps equipped with an efficient permanent magnet motor. The electronic BFPM control unit must be used for controlling BFPM motor pumps (see separate datasheet for the electronic BFPM control unit). The BFPM 52 is intended for small oil burners up to 24 l/h.

Functions
Operation
Oil is drawn from the suction port (S) through the filter (H) to the gear set, where the pressure is increased. The diaphragm (D) in the pressure regulator for stage 1 (T1) maintains the pressure at a constant value set by the adjustment screw (P1). When voltage is applied to the NC valve, it opens, allowing oil to reach the nozzle outlet (E).
When voltage is applied to the NO valve, it closes, and the pressure regulator (T1) is taken out of operation. The pressure then rises to the value for stage 2, set by the adjustment screw (P2).
In a 2-strand system, excess oil is returned to the return port (R) and back to the tank. In a 1-strand system with a closed return port (R) and the screw (A) removed, the oil is internally recirculated to the gear set (see diagram).

Shutdown Function, Solenoid Valve
When the burner stops, the voltage to the solenoid valves is removed. The NO valve opens, and the NC valve closes, immediately cutting off the oil flow to the nozzle.
Venting
In a 2-strand system, the pump is self-priming; venting occurs via the orifice (O) to the return port (R). In a 1-strand system with a closed return port (R), venting occurs via the nozzle outlet (E) or the manometer port (P).
Note! ? The NC solenoid valve must be replaced after 250,000 switching cycles or after 10 years (verified lifespan).
Product Details
General Data
Specification | Value |
---|---|
Oil Types | Standard heating oil and heating oil according to DIN V 51603-6 EL A Bio-10 (max. 10 % FAME) |
Viscosity Range (measured at suction port) | (1.3) 1.8 to 12.0 cSt. (mm²/s) |
Filter Area/Mesh Size | 11 cm² / 200 µm |
Pressure Range 1) | 7 to 15 bar (Stage 1) 10 to 25 bar (Stage 2) |
Factory Setting | 10 ±1 bar (Stage 1) 13 ±1 bar (Stage 2) |
Max. Pressure at Suction and Return Ports | 2 bar |
Speed | 400 to 3400 min⁻¹ |
Ambient/Transport Temperature | -20 to +70° C |
Medium Temperature | 0 to +70° C |
Power Supply/Drive BFPM Motor 2) | 230 V regulated, from the control unit |
Coil Power Consumption | 9 W |
Coil Nominal Voltage | 230 V, 50/60 Hz |
Coil Protection Type | IP 40 |
1) Max. 12 bar at 1.3 cSt., max. 15 bar at 1.8 cSt.
2) Caution: Do not connect the BFPM motor directly to 230 V/50 Hz!
